Granada Hare vs Nubra Pika
Lepus granatensis compared with Ochotona nubrica
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Granada Hare | Nubra Pika |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order same |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ares) |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Family | Leporidae (Rabbits & Hares) | Ochotonidae |
| Genus | Lepus | Ochotona |
| Species | Lepus granatensis | Ochotona nubrica |
Evolutionary Relationship
Granada Hare and Nubra Pika share a common ancestor at the Order level: Lagomorpha. (Rabbits & Hares)
